Born in Spanish Town, Jamaica and given the name Barrington Bennett. At the age of six, Barrington's parents moved to kingston where he attended Vauvhall Secondary School. This was where Barrington's interest in music began and he got the nick name Bembeh.He played congo and bongo drums in the school's annual pantomine. After leaving school in 1971, Bembeh moved back to Spanish Town where he enter local talent shows. This led him to The Wright Brothers Band. He developed his skills as a singer and Mc for the band. Over the next five years Bembeh worked with several Bands doing shows all over the island.He eventually landed a gig at the hottes night club in Spanish Town called Big Daddy's club. This was the place where Barrington met and introduced on stage artist the likes Delroy Wilson, Phyllis Dillion, Carl Darkins and may more. One night after performing at the club, Barrington was approched by one of the members of Rags and Riches singing group. He was asked to join the group to replace one of their former members. This meeting exposed Bembeh to bigger shows. The group performed at the Christmas morning concert at the Carib Theater and many big shows all over the Island;working with Gregory Issacs,Dennis Brown,Ken Booth just to name a few. Barrington migrated to the US in 1980.He hooked up with some of his friends who had also migrated to the US, The first two Band he sang with was called, Izes then the Heritage Band.
